The available data base is examined to constrain the Rb/Cs ratio of the earth and its bulk K, Rb, and Cs contents. Analogous data on lunar rocks are reviewed in order to compare the Rb/Cs ratio of the silicate earth (SE) and moon and to test whether Rb and Cs abundances can be used to constrain models of lunar origin. The continental crust is found to have an Rb/Cs ratio of about 25, whereas the depleted MORB source and OIB plume source regions have Rb/Cs ratios of about 80. There is evidence suggesting a secular change in the Rb/Cs ratios of the depleted mantle. The Rb/Cs ratio in the SE is estimated to be about 28. The continental crust contains about 37 percent of the total K present in the SE, 50 percent of its Rb, and 55 percent of its Cs, whereas the residual mantle contains about 20 percent of the K, 10 percent of the Rb, and only 4 percent of the Cs. The average Rb/Cs ratio for all lunar samples is about 22, a ratio similar to that of the SE.
